Description of πŸ’‘ Landlite Incandescent-Style LED Bulbs: An Authentic and Efficient Traditional Lighting Alternative

2PC Landlite LED T10 120V 5W, for Piano Light / Banker Light, 40W incandescent equivalent, Completely traditional T10 shape Glass bulb. 120V, E26 base, frosted soft warmwhite 2700K, 450lm, Dimmable. Ideal for Piano light, Banker light. Lifespan:15000hrs, 6Month Limited Warranty. Fragile products, If you received damaged glass bulbs, no need return, just contact seller for free replacements.

Nice warm light. on light bulbs

The standard bulb in my wife's souvenir cupboard burned out so quickly that I decided on an LED. I wasn't sure about the "warmth" or color of such an LED, but I was pleasantly surprised. The light output is almost identical to an incandescent bulb and I expect this bulb to last for several years.

I didn't want the piano light to be too bright. This is probably the 35 watt equivalent of an incandescent bulb. That's right! It flickered for the first few hours of use so I was concerned. After burning through (although staying cold) it was stable and just what I wanted. Update: After a few months it started flickering and then got worse. Finally it was off for a while.
